ASTROPHYSICS:
Cluster Reveals Earth's Rippling Magnetic Field

Barbara Casassus and Alexander Hellemans

PARIS--Four satellites flying in unison have revealed a hidden wild side to Earth's magnetosphere, the magnetic field enveloping the planet that acts like a gigantic deflector shield against blasts of solar radiation. The unprecedented view, unveiled here last week at European Space Agency headquarters, could help scientists devise better defenses against crippling magnetic storms.
